对Windows Vista的批评
系列条目 |
Windows Vista |
---|
Windows Vista为2006年11月由微软所发布的操作系统,但在隐私问题、安全性、性能、翻译、产品启动等方面均受到评论者或用户的不少批评。
硬件需求
虽然微软宣称“几近现今所有市场上的电脑皆能够运行Vista”(2005年)[1],且2005年后所销售的电脑大多数也有能力运行Vista。但Vista一些较为豪华的功能,像是Aero接口,影响许多升级电脑的用户。但许多曾在XP中的硬件,转至Vista版本时并无法正常工作,或者工作性能并不到预期水准,导致许多企业对此缺乏兴趣,转而支持使用旧的软硬件。为此,Vista Service Pack 1中曾企图修复许多这类问题。
速度
Tom's 硬件指南在2007年1月发布其所做的十大应用测试结果中,表明Windows Vista的应用程式执行速度比典型的Windows XP,以相同的硬件配置还要慢。硬件指南认为性能下降的原因,是由于Vista在其激进的设计变更时,并没有考虑其实际运作的功效。但也有人指出这种“结果不应被相比”,提出这些试验所运行的电脑是在主要运行Windows XP时制造,即使测试不应是用相同的硬件配置。由于硬件规格问体,而导致可能出现“无效的比较”。如在两次测试WinRAR和Adobe Photoshop的实际应用上,Vista分别快了21.8%和5.5%左右,其余的三个应用程式运行在XP和Vista中,只有约2%之间的差异,几乎可以忽略不计。
许多低到中性能的电脑,由于Windows Vista预先装设导致其性能异常缓慢,部分手提电脑制造商已表示愿意协助将手提电脑“降级”到Windows XP的版本。
文件操作的性能
2006年11月首次发布,Vista所执行的文件操作,如复制和删除的速度皆比其他操作系统慢。当有一大文件需要从一台电脑迁移到另一台十分困难,这种无法有效地执行基本文件操作,引起强烈的批评。六个月后,微软证实存在这些问题,并透过释放一增进性能和可靠性的更新来加以改进,并借由包含Service Pack 1的Windows更新后发布。然而一个报告显示,以同时提高性能相比,Vista的原始版本在加强至Service Pack 1的水平时,亦没有比Windows XP操作系统特别突出。
游戏性能
在Vista的发布的早期时,许多游戏仍主要是以Windows XP作为平台推出。这导致很大程度上,Vista得使用不成熟的图形处理器的驱动程式,导致Vista本身有更高的系统要求。最近的一些指针表示,截至2008年年中,以Vista的SP1版本推出的游戏游戏性能等同于现在Windows XP。然而,游戏开发者所设置在Vista推荐的内建要求仍然比在XP中运行较高。
系统庞大
相关人士表示Windows Vista软件算是蓄意肥大。2007年在伊利诺伊大学,微软杰出工程师 Eric Traut说:“很多人认为 Windows操作系统为一庞大、臃肿的操作系统,这我不得不承认。”他接着说“作为一切的核心,由内核和组件所构成的操作系统,实际上是可以相当精简。”
PC World的编辑Ed Bott曾为软件肥大提出警告,并指出几乎所有微软出售的每一样单一的操作系统,都曾经被批评为“臃肿”,即使是他们第一次推出的MS-DOS也是一样。
Vista的官司
两个消费者在美国联邦法院起诉微软,指控“Windows Vista Capable”营销活动是一个诈欺的诱饵,大量推广原来安装Windows XP的电脑升级至Vista,但在某些情况下,没有一位用户可以接受电脑在Vista运行的速度。2008年2月西雅图法官给予诉讼集体诉讼地位,允许所有买家一同参与这次诉讼。
另外,根据英国报社The Times于2006年5月的报导,英国只有不到半成的电脑能够跑的动所有Vista的功能[2]。微软缺乏明确的解释,导致一群用户向法院提出集体诉讼,控告微软用户无法执行贴有"Vista Capable"标志的Vista电脑[3]。法院公布了微软内部的通讯,揭露了副行政总裁Mike Nash抱怨他的台式电脑的主机版所内建的图型处理晶片无法处理某些Vista的功能,“我的电脑成了一台$2100美元的电邮收发机”[4]。
手提电脑的电池寿命
随着拥有新功能的Vista,关于使用运行Vista的手提电脑其电池功率已经出现许多批评,因为其可以比Windows XP更快消耗电池电量,减少电池的使用寿命。当将Windows Aero的视觉效果关闭时,电池寿命也顶多是等于或者仍是小于Windows XP系统。“一个新的操作系统由于它的新特性和更高的要求,需要更高的功率消耗是一定的”IDC的一位分析师Richard Shim指出“当Windows XP推出时,这是对的;当Windows 98推出时,这仍是对的。”
安全性
用户账户控制
很多用户[谁?]批评新的用户账户控制(UAC)的安全技术,因为许多第三方程式时并不遵循最小权限原则,需要用户以管理员身份运行,以致每次安装应用程式或变更设置时,都会弹出UAC的提示对话框,带来了不便及麻烦。这原因是因为过去一段时间以来,微软一直建议厂商将程序编写为可由普通用户身份运行。但是在所有的使用户默认情况下,在以前版本的Windows中管理员的权限跟一般使用户的权限是模糊的,因此许多开发商都错误地设置这些权限。
用户账户控制可以透过控制面板被关闭,但是这也将禁止使用一些由权限分离所使出的功能,如Internet Explorer 7的安全浏览模式;这是因为Internet Explorer 7这模式是依赖UAC的运作,把有风险内容的文件,先把其虚拟化再恢复到原来的样子。
对驱动程式的限制
64位版本的Windows Vista只允许已有登记的驱动程式,安装于用户态模式上,这功能不能轻易的由系统管理员取消。为了让获得登记,开发人员不得不向微软支付金费,已借由微软的WHQL测试其驱动程式来获得认证;或者如果WHQL测试并不是必要的,则得与需签署的驱动程式购买“软件发行者证书”。
由于下面的批评 /索赔逼迫微软对此另行规定:
- 如此将会减少对Vista的兼容旧硬件
- 由于不接受从爱好者社区所做出的试验,这对小型开发场商是不利的;想在Vista驱动的程序在其电子证书是极为昂贵的,平均约每年400到500美元(由VeriSign指出)。
- 它不仅只限制安全相关的程序,也包括有数码著作权管理争议的程序,特别是针对受保障的视频路径而言。
未经登记且可安装的驱动程式,在默认中仅包括Vista上的初期使用工具,以及部分第三方工具,例如Atsiv。但微软Service Pack 1中,已经借由修复程序KB932596修改。微软声称采用严格的驱动程式审查,意味着将会有更多的安全性,但一些批评者[谁?]认为现在几乎很少有任何安全攻击,是直接且蓄意的放在软件驱动程式上,且大多数的驱动程式几乎是由装置制造商自行编写出的。一些使用UltraDefrag开发人员亦也抱怨此功能,因为这会防止他们的所需的“ultradfg.sys”加载。
内建保护功能的缺陷
安全性研究人员Alexander Sotirov和Mark Dowd已开发出一种技术,可破解新增许多有效保护功能的Windows Vista中。借由在Vista中任何已经知存在的缓冲器溢出错误,利用系统并未加以利用或管理的,透过其特性进而破解电脑的安全保护功能。“这本身并不只是一个弱点”Alexander Sotirov指出,“我们仅是提出的哪些在保护机制上将会弱点。系统仍有其他可能受到攻击的漏洞。在没有找出存在的漏洞前,这些安全技术并不真正解决任何事情。”
数码著作权管理
另一种常见的批评是于操作系统中,关于规范化的数码著作权管理(DRM),尤其是的视频路径(PVP)特别受到保护,其中亦涉及到了HDCP和ICT等技术。这功能被添加到Vista的原因,主要是因为微软与好莱坞工作室双方的协议所导致。除了有关软件的其他事项外,这也将涉及HD DVD和蓝光光碟里面需保护著作权的内容,但在2010年前仍未有具体限制。
在与影片的软件上,在发送指定的内容时,可能会因此出现受“保护”的提示,更甚者可能会被可能被拦截。此外,所有的接口有关协议的内容时,必须通过微软认证方能使用。在开始播放之前,所涉及的所有装置使用的硬件功能将会被检查扫描,验证是否是真版,且并没有被篡改过的;而不支持HDCP保护者,接口将会被关闭或蓄意降低任何信号输出效率。此外,由于微软针对全球的指定清单的装置已被破坏,目前这份名单是透过网络将消息分发到个人电脑,并于网络上拥有更新机制。这样的唯一的影响为撤销部分协议的限定功能,其中高级别的指定内容仍不能使用,其他功能包括低清晰度转放则持续保留。
自由软件基金会曾因此对Vista进行一项名为“BadVista”游行运动。
值得注意的批评
新西兰奥克兰大学电脑安全专家Peter Gutmann在其发行的白皮书中,对这机制提出了以下几个问题:
- 增加加密措施,使接口变得更加昂贵,而其成本将会反应到用户上。
- 如果输出的接口并不具支持,那么依此即使是不错的接口也可能被要求关闭(如S/PDIF)。
- 因为制造商可能另有要求,一些较新的高清晰度显示器并不支持HDCP功能。
- 新增加的功能,由于其复杂性使系统更加不可靠。
- 由于部分非指定的媒体并没有受到限制,可能会因此鼓励用户改变选择,来观看这些没有限制的内容,进而击败了这计划的最初目的。
- 保护机制可能会触发错误等消息,导致使用户拒绝服务。
- 取消认证的产品,广泛是受使用户好评的的软件,Peter Gutmann怀疑微软能否成为有史以来第一为这样真正实现的能力。但另一方面,他们可能因为受对电影工作室的法律义务,而仍会被迫真正落实。
对批评的反应
Windows Vista软件编辑者Ed Bott,在blog上写了三篇文章,驳斥了许多Gutmann的说法。Ed Bott的批评可以概括如下:
- Gutmann的论文资料取自微软过时的文件和二手网络资料。
- Gutmann选择性地采纳微软公布的规格。
- Gutmann并没有使用Vista来证明他的理论。相反地,他先做出错误的假设,然后再疯狂地推测其影响。
- Gutmann的文件,表面上为一认真的研究,旦实际上顶多只能算是是一意见而已。
科技作家George Ou亦认为,Gutmann的文件依赖不可靠的来源,且从未使用过Windows Vista来测试他的理论。此外,微软亦已在blog上发布了《二十个问题(及答案)》和其他在Windows Vista的内容保护上的相关文章,准备反驳一些Gutmann的论点。微软还指出,内容保护机制早在Windows版本为Windows Me时就已经存在了。
Gutmann在回应Bott和Ou双方的文章中提到,其文章并没有被驳倒,并指出Bott所住的三篇文章为“谣言”。而微软最有价值专家Paul Smith在回应Gutmann的文件中,提到了他的一些论点,其中包括了:
- 微软不能反对这些管理措施,因为公司已被迫为电影工作室做到这一点。
- 视频路径将不会被被立刻限制相当一段时间。有人说这是微软和索尼之间的另一项协议,至少到2010年为止蓝光光碟并不会被管制,甚至可能直到2012年。
- 其他操作系统如Linux、Mac OS X的用户,并不能正式访问这些内容。
软件兼容性
在Vista下运行其他软件出现了重大问题。Gartner声称:“Vista已经造成许多的困扰,并证明在某些情况下,许多现有的应用程式为了在新的系统上运行都必须重新被编写。” PC World指出:“软件兼容性问题,将会导致企业在随着微软更新操作系统时,因为‘担忧成本和兼容性’,导至持续产生矛盾心理。”美国运输部禁止下辖员工将操作系统升级至Vista;美国匹兹堡大学医学中心表示,新推出的Vista明显早于原预定的时间表,因为“几个关键的程序仍然互不兼容,包括病人调度软件。”
截至2007年7月为止,有超过2000项测试应用程式能与Vista兼容。微软并公布了名单,指出哪些应用程式支持他们“于Windows Vista作业”的软件标准,以达到更严格的“Windows Vista认证”的标准。然而截至2007年7月,软件兼容性问题仍然阻碍Vista系统的推广。微软亦发布了应用程式兼容性工具包5.0,让不兼容的应用程式仍能在Vista运作。此外,用户也能自行使用硬件虚拟化技术,如VirtualBox、Microsoft Virtual PC、VMware等来执行过去Windows时代编写的产品。
取消的功能
微软也被批评为取消一些常被讨论的创新功能,如2004年5月取消的下一代安全计算基础、2004年8月取消的WinFS、2005年8月取消的Windows PowerShell(尽管这在Vista的发布,是被列入在Vista的继任者Windows 7的计划中)、2006年5月取消的SecurID。最初Vista开发项目的“三大支柱”都没随着Vista推出。
价格
微软对Vista的国际定价,已经被许多人批评过于昂贵。从一个国家到另一个国家彼此的价格差别很大。在许多情况下,由于Windows XP操作系统,导致价格差异依地域特别大。在马来西亚,Vista的定价大约 RM799($244 /€155);而依目前的汇率,英国的消费者得支付较美国多一倍的价钱购买相同的软件。
Windows Vista在2007年1月时,微软已经降低了Vista的零售和升级价格。原本Vista旗舰版价格为399美元、而Vista家庭高级版则为239美元,至今两样分别已减至319和199美元。
软件保护平台
Vista拥有一强化的设置防拷贝技术,并接续Windows XP的Windows正版增值计划,这被称为软件保护平台(SPP)。在最初的版本的Windows Vista(并没下载Service Pack 1),这是一时常失败的功能,在升级时常会出现“失败的产品激活”,或者误认说他们的版本“为假冒或非正版”。在Microsoft的白皮书被描述为:
“当默认的Web浏览器将被启动,用户将看到一个选择购买新的产品密钥。同时会没有开始菜单、桌面图标,且桌面背景将会变为黑色......一小时后,系统会再次提出警告。”
这被批评为过于严苛,特别是考虑到误判时,以及临时性验证服务停止时的误认,有许多报导指出需多正版XP升级至Vista时,以及Windows更新时,也常被判断成“非正版”。
对话框翻译错误
在繁体中文版的Windows Vista,其对话框的翻译错误比过往多了一些,有部分内容甚至是不符合繁体中文的文法规则。
销售数字的夸大
据业内人士透露,截至2008年7月底为止,的Windows XP的销量仍然是超过Windows Vista,特别是在企业销售方面。据惠普公司人士指出,微软不道德的操纵和夸大Windows Vista的销售数字。
Windows Ultimate Extras
尽管Windows Vista旗舰版用户可以优先下载独家的Windows Ultimate Extras功能,这些软件已比预期发布慢得许多,且到2009年8月只有四个功能可用,这已到了Vista发放的第三年。这激怒了一些用户,认为微软在附加组件上开了个空头支票。Windows Vista Ultimate负责主任Barry Goffe指出:“微软计划发布一个集合额外功能的Windows Ultimate Extras,并相信这将取悦热情的Windows Vista客户。”
与新旧版本比较
目前网络及媒体上的论点几乎都是,Windows 7的测试版比Windows Vista好很多;而在Windows 7正式版上市前,许多用户[谁?]在购买电脑时也会要求店家将Windows Vista降级为旧版本的Windows XP。
参见
参考资料
- ^ Spooner, John G. Will Your PC Run Windows Vista?. eweek.com. 2005-08-05 [2006-08-15]. 已忽略未知参数
|coatuhors=
(帮助) - ^ Judge, Elizabeth. Windows revamp 'too advanced for most PCs'. The Times. 2006-05-20 [2006-08-15].
- ^ Gregg Keizer (November 26, 2007).Lawyers: Even Microsoft Confused Over Vista Marketing
- ^ "They Criticized Vista. And They Should Know.", The New York Times, March 9 2008.